Output 5d90520ae2bd16571a44c2bb67969a612d83f0a486084239d161dfdcaaeb2cdc:0

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75431e1865efcb653007c61a4c8a12083ebf5550 OP_EQUAL
address
3CP3PQ2Bz5xtkUwwKj3ayq7yPYbGrwb53t
transaction
5d90520ae2bd16571a44c2bb67969a612d83f0a486084239d161dfdcaaeb2cdc
spent
true